5 REASONS YOUR SKIN LOOKS OLDER THAN IT SHOULD BE

skin mistakes

Aging is part of life but if you fear that your skin is aging faster than it should be, then it’s important to take a good and hard look at some lifestyles that could be causing your skin to look older than it should be.

Here are 5 reasons your skin look older than it should be

1. FAILURE TO USE SUNSCREEN AND GOOD SUNGLASSES

The skin around your eyes is extremely thin and requires extra attention so failure to apply sunscreen in that area can worsen wrinkles and discoloration. When you use sunglasses without UVA/UVB protection, you exacerbate frown lines and eye wrinkles. Always ensure you apply sunscreen and use sunglasses with UVA/UVB protection. Don’t forget to wear hats or caps too.

2. BIRTH-CONTROL PILLS

You can get facial hyperpigmentation caused by hormonal surges during pregnancy by using birth-control pills. This causes brownish-gray patches to appear like shadows on the upper lip, cheeks, forehead and nose and this type of discolouration can add years to your face. This hormone-induced melasma usually fades within a year of going off the pill.

3. TOO MUCH ALCOHOL

Alcohol consumption makes your skin look older than it should be by dehydrating your body and depleting your stores of B vitamins and magnesium, which you need for good skin. Ensure you drink enough water during and after alcohol consumption.

4. FAILURE TO GET ENOUGH SLEEP

Lack of proper sleep is really bad for the skin. Cellular rejuvenation does its best work during sleep and when you fail to get adequate sleep, you disrupt the process. Ensure you get at least 7 hours of sleep every day.

5. STRESS

Stress is also bad news for your skin and can make you look older than you really are. Ensure you reduce the amount of stress you go through because the body uses up various nutrients including magnesium and vitamin C when you are stressed to create stress hormones such as cortisol, adrenaline and noradrenaline so you can cope with the stress.
